#947ca4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#947ca4 is composed of 58% red, 48.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.8% cyan, 24.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 276 degrees, a saturation of 18% and a lightness of 56.5%. #947ca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#290049.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#947ca4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070508 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#947ca4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918d93 is the less saturated color, while #a527f9 is the most saturated one.
